The efficiency of industrial machinery heavily relies on the technology employed within its components. Integrated Gate Bipolar Transistor (IGBT) technology has emerged as a key player, especially in the realm of medium frequency generators. This innovation combines the best of both bipolar and MOSFET technologies, offering high efficiency and fast switching capabilities. As a result, systems using an IGBT Solid State Medium Frequency Generator can capitalize on reduced energy consumption while maximizing output performance.

Industries from metal processing to medical equipment manufacturing are increasingly adopting this technology. For instance, in the metal industry, an IGBT Solid State Medium Frequency Generator allows for precise control of heating, which is essential for applications like induction heating. By achieving accurate temperature control, manufacturers can produce higher-quality products with fewer defects, leading to even more significant cost savings.
